/external/tpm2-tss/src/tss2-esys/api/ |
D | Esys_StartAuthSession.c | 30 TPMI_ALG_HASH authHash) in store_input_parameters() argument 35 esysContext->in.StartAuthSession.authHash = authHash; in store_input_parameters() 106 TPMI_ALG_HASH authHash, ESYS_TR *sessionHandle) in Esys_StartAuthSession() argument 112 symmetric, authHash); in Esys_StartAuthSession() 187 TPMI_ALG_HASH authHash) in Esys_StartAuthSession_Async() argument 194 symmetric, authHash); in Esys_StartAuthSession_Async() 215 symmetric, authHash); in Esys_StartAuthSession_Async() 229 r2 = iesys_crypto_hash_get_digest_size(authHash,&authHash_size); in Esys_StartAuthSession_Async() 247 authHash); in Esys_StartAuthSession_Async() 355 rsrc->misc.rsrc_session.authHash = esysContext->in.StartAuthSession.authHash; in Esys_StartAuthSession_Finish() [all …]
|
/external/ms-tpm-20-ref/TPMCmd/tpm/src/command/EA/ |
D | PolicySigned.c | 63 TPM2B_DIGEST authHash; in TPM2_PolicySigned() local 102 authHash.t.size = CryptHashStart(&hashState, in TPM2_PolicySigned() 107 if(authHash.t.size == 0) in TPM2_PolicySigned() 123 CryptHashEnd2B(&hashState, &authHash.b); in TPM2_PolicySigned() 127 result = CryptValidateSignature(in->authObject, &authHash, &in->auth); in TPM2_PolicySigned()
|
D | PolicyAuthorize.c | 57 TPM2B_DIGEST authHash; in TPM2_PolicyAuthorize() local 93 authHash.t.size = CryptHashStart(&hashState, hashAlg); in TPM2_PolicyAuthorize() 102 CryptHashEnd2B(&hashState, &authHash.b); in TPM2_PolicyAuthorize() 105 TicketComputeVerified(in->checkTicket.hierarchy, &authHash, in TPM2_PolicyAuthorize()
|
/external/tpm2-tss/src/tss2-sys/api/ |
D | Tss2_Sys_StartAuthSession.c | 23 TPMI_ALG_HASH authHash) in Tss2_Sys_StartAuthSession_Prepare() argument 31 if (IsAlgorithmWeak(authHash, 0)) in Tss2_Sys_StartAuthSession_Prepare() 94 rval = Tss2_MU_UINT16_Marshal(authHash, ctx->cmdBuffer, in Tss2_Sys_StartAuthSession_Prepare() 143 TPMI_ALG_HASH authHash, in Tss2_Sys_StartAuthSession() argument 154 …on_Prepare(sysContext, tpmKey, bind, nonceCaller, encryptedSalt, sessionType, symmetric, authHash); in Tss2_Sys_StartAuthSession()
|
/external/tpm2-tss/src/tss2-esys/ |
D | esys_iutil.c | 235 session->rsrc.misc.rsrc_session.authHash) { in iesys_compute_cp_hashtab() 243 authHash, ccBuffer, name1, name2, name3, in iesys_compute_cp_hashtab() 250 session->rsrc.misc.rsrc_session.authHash; in iesys_compute_cp_hashtab() 298 if (rp_hash_tab[j].alg == session->rsrc.misc.rsrc_session.authHash) { in iesys_compute_rp_hashtab() 305 r = iesys_crypto_rpHash(session->rsrc.misc.rsrc_session.authHash, in iesys_compute_rp_hashtab() 311 session->rsrc.misc.rsrc_session.authHash; in iesys_compute_rp_hashtab() 669 r = iesys_crypto_hash_get_digest_size(rsrc_session->authHash, &hlen); in iesys_encrypt_param() 695 r = iesys_crypto_KDFa(rsrc_session->authHash, in iesys_encrypt_param() 716 r = iesys_xor_parameter_obfuscation(rsrc_session->authHash, in iesys_encrypt_param() 767 r = iesys_crypto_hash_get_digest_size(rsrc_session->authHash, &hlen); in iesys_decrypt_param() [all …]
|
D | esys_types.h | 56 TPMI_ALG_HASH authHash; /**< Hashalg used for authorization */ member
|
D | esys_int.h | 33 TPMI_ALG_HASH authHash; member
|
D | esys_mu.c | 420 ret = Tss2_MU_TPMI_ALG_HASH_Marshal(src->authHash, buffer, size, &offset_loc); in iesys_MU_IESYS_SESSION_Marshal() 508 (dst == NULL)? &out_authHash : &dst->authHash); in iesys_MU_IESYS_SESSION_Unmarshal()
|
/external/tpm2-tss/test/integration/ |
D | sapi-session-util.c | 49 session->nonceOlder.size = GetDigestSize(session->authHash); in start_auth_session() 60 session->authHash, &session->sessionHandle, in start_auth_session() 90 bytes = GetDigestSize(session->authHash) * 8; in start_auth_session() 92 rval = KDFa(session->authHash, (TPM2B *)&key, label, in start_auth_session() 123 session->authHash, command, &pHash); in compute_session_auth() 150 rval = hmac(session->authHash, hmacKey->buffer, in compute_session_auth() 305 session->authHash = algId; in create_auth_session() 345 TPMI_ALG_HASH authHash, in tpm_calc_phash() argument 427 rval = hash(authHash, hashInput.buffer, hashInput.size, pHash); in tpm_calc_phash() 569 rval = KDFa (session->authHash, in gen_session_key() [all …]
|
D | esys-audit.int.c | 150 TPMI_ALG_HASH authHash = TPM2_ALG_SHA256; in test_esys_audit() local 156 sessionType, &symmetric, authHash, &session); in test_esys_audit()
|
D | session-util.h | 23 TPMI_ALG_HASH authHash; member
|
D | esys-create-session-auth.int.c | 238 TPMI_ALG_HASH authHash = TPM2_ALG_SHA256; in test_esys_create_session_auth() local 261 sessionType, &symmetric, authHash, &session); in test_esys_create_session_auth()
|
/external/ms-tpm-20-ref/TPMCmd/tpm/src/command/Session/ |
D | StartAuthSession.c | 76 || in->nonceCaller.t.size > CryptHashGetDigestSize(in->authHash)) in TPM2_StartAuthSession() 159 result = SessionCreate(in->sessionType, in->authHash, &in->nonceCaller, in TPM2_StartAuthSession()
|
/external/ms-tpm-20-ref/TPMCmd/tpm/include/prototypes/ |
D | StartAuthSession_fp.h | 53 TPMI_ALG_HASH authHash; member
|
D | Session_fp.h | 130 TPMI_ALG_HASH authHash, // IN: the hash algorithm
|
/external/ms-tpm-20-ref/TPMCmd/tpm/src/subsystem/ |
D | Session.c | 452 TPMI_ALG_HASH authHash, // IN: the hash algorithm in SessionCreate() argument 503 session->authHashAlg = authHash; in SessionCreate()
|
/external/tpm2-tss/include/tss2/ |
D | tss2_sys.h | 187 TPMI_ALG_HASH authHash); 203 TPMI_ALG_HASH authHash,
|
D | tss2_esys.h | 303 TPMI_ALG_HASH authHash, 317 TPMI_ALG_HASH authHash);
|
/external/tpm2-tss/test/unit/ |
D | esys-tcti-rcs.c | 443 TPMI_ALG_HASH authHash = TPM2_ALG_SHA1; in test_StartAuthSession() local 455 authHash, &sessionHandle_handle); in test_StartAuthSession()
|
D | esys-tpm-rcs.c | 423 TPMI_ALG_HASH authHash = TPM2_ALG_SHA1; in test_StartAuthSession() local 435 authHash, &sessionHandle_handle); in test_StartAuthSession()
|
D | esys-resubmissions.c | 454 TPMI_ALG_HASH authHash = TPM2_ALG_SHA1; in test_StartAuthSession() local 466 authHash, &sessionHandle_handle); in test_StartAuthSession()
|
/external/ms-tpm-20-ref/TPMCmd/tpm/include/ |
D | CommandDispatcher.h | 122 result = TPMI_ALG_HASH_Unmarshal(&in->authHash, paramBuffer, paramBufferSize, FALSE);
|
D | CommandDispatchData.h | 540 (UINT16)(offsetof(StartAuthSession_In, authHash)),
|
/external/tpm2-tss/doc/ |
D | doxygen.dox | 905 …M2B_NONCE *nonceCaller, TPM2_SE sessionType, const TPMT_SYM_DEF *symmetric, TPMI_ALG_HASH authHash) 907 …ller, TPM2_SE sessionType, const TPMT_SYM_DEF *symmetric, TPMI_ALG_HASH authHash, ESYS_TR *session…
|